From 4f7d18f483d807fb07b3f466ddd4441f2c19ab9e Mon Sep 17 00:00:00 2001 From: itgaojian Date: Thu, 22 Feb 2024 10:24:47 +0800 Subject: [PATCH] =?UTF-8?q?=E7=AD=BE=E5=88=B0=E8=AE=B0=E5=BD=95=E9=A1=B5?= =?UTF-8?q?=E9=9D=A2?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- app/build.gradle | 3 + app/release/output-metadata.json | 4 +- app/src/main/AndroidManifest.xml | 23 ++---- .../activitys/common/SignRecordActivity.java | 16 +++++ .../activitys/common/WorkSignActivity.java | 5 +- .../main/res/layout/activity_sign_record.xml | 71 +++++++++++++++++++ .../main/res/layout/activity_work_sign.xml | 18 ++++- app/src/main/res/values-night/themes.xml | 7 ++ app/src/main/res/values/attrs.xml | 20 +++--- app/src/main/res/values/colors.xml | 5 ++ app/src/main/res/values/strings.xml | 3 + app/src/main/res/values/styles.xml | 10 +++ app/src/main/res/values/themes.xml | 13 ++++ 13 files changed, 168 insertions(+), 30 deletions(-) create mode 100644 app/src/main/java/com/sucstepsoft/realtimelocation/activitys/common/SignRecordActivity.java create mode 100644 app/src/main/res/layout/activity_sign_record.xml create mode 100644 app/src/main/res/values-night/themes.xml create mode 100644 app/src/main/res/values/themes.xml diff --git a/app/build.gradle b/app/build.gradle index baf917d..8090931 100755 --- a/app/build.gradle +++ b/app/build.gradle @@ -53,6 +53,9 @@ android { keyPassword '123456' } } + buildFeatures { + viewBinding true + } } dependencies { implementation fileTree(dir: 'libs', include: ['*.jar']) diff --git a/app/release/output-metadata.json b/app/release/output-metadata.json index dde8ab2..01432b2 100644 --- a/app/release/output-metadata.json +++ b/app/release/output-metadata.json @@ -10,8 +10,8 @@ { "type": "SINGLE", "filters": [], - "versionCode": 51, - "versionName": "1.5.1", + "versionCode": 52, + "versionName": "1.5.2", "outputFile": "app-release.apk" } ] diff --git a/app/src/main/AndroidManifest.xml b/app/src/main/AndroidManifest.xml index be886e1..044776d 100755 --- a/app/src/main/AndroidManifest.xml +++ b/app/src/main/AndroidManifest.xml @@ -48,12 +48,17 @@ android:theme="@style/AppTheme" android:usesCleartextTraffic="true" tools:ignore="GoogleAppIndexingWarning"> + - - - - - - - - - - - - - - - - - > mPenLineList; private BaiduMap mBaiduMap; private BDLocation mCurrent; @@ -188,7 +189,9 @@ public class WorkSignActivity extends BaseActivity { getCurrentTime(); checkSign(); mLlSign.setOnClickListener(v -> doSign()); + mBtnSignRecord.setOnClickListener(v->startActivity(new Intent(mActivity,SignRecordActivity.class))); refreshView(STATE_LOAD_SUCCESS); + } /** diff --git a/app/src/main/res/layout/activity_sign_record.xml b/app/src/main/res/layout/activity_sign_record.xml new file mode 100644 index 0000000..8cb7890 --- /dev/null +++ b/app/src/main/res/layout/activity_sign_record.xml @@ -0,0 +1,71 @@ + + + + + + + + + + + + + + + + + + + + + + + + + + + +